Job description

Resort Groundskeepers perform a variety of landscaping maintenance and snow removal duties (where applicable). They regularly mow lawns, weed, plant flowers, plow snow, remove debris from property grounds, and overall ensure our resorts are well-maintained and look presentable. Resort Groundskeepers also work to ensure our residents and guests receive quality customer service. On occasion, Resort Groundskeepers may help out with light maintenance work throughout the property.

Job Duties
  • Ensures lawns are manicured appropriately (Essential)
  • Regularly treat weeds for weed control, weed whip, rake leaves, plant flowers/shrubs, spread mulch/woodchips/stones, trim shrubs and hedges, cut down and remove tree limbs damaged by adverse weather conditions, and perform other lawn care services (Essential)
  • Picks-up trash and debris from common areas and streets on a daily basis. Empties trash in common areas, shoveling, performing maintenance or repair duties, using saws, weed eaters, blowers, mowers, drills or other hand tools (Essential)
  • Inspects irrigation system regularly to ensure it is working properly; repairs as needed (Essential)
  • Reports all resort maintenance issues and concerns that they may identify while performing their daily duties directly to their manager (Essential)
  • Maintains resort vehicles and equipment (Essential)
  • Ensures resort is presentable at all times and adheres to Sun's curb appeal standards
  • If applicable, maintains resort pool(s), testing chemical levels, adjusting appropriately
  • Safely operates vehicles for the purpose of performing job duties
  • Follows safety procedures while performing duties
  • Other duties and special projects as assigned
Requirements
  • High School Diploma or GED (Required)
  • 6 months in previous groundskeeping experience in the resort industry (Preferred)
  • Demonstrated knowledge of and broad experience in general grounds maintenance techniques
  • Ability to endure seasonal temperatures as working conditions requires constant outdoor work
  • Proficient skills in operating various hand tools, power equipment, and commercial machinery
  • Ability to provide legible written reports
  • Ability to work well independently as well as a team
  • Ability to lift at least 25 pounds
  • Basic computer proficiency, including the ability to use email and the internet
  • Must have a valid driver's license
